# Source Build and CLI Commands
This guide covers the source-build workflow, common CLI commands, repository paths, and output locations. For the fastest first run, use the `npx` workflow in the main README.
## Prerequisites
- Docker
- Node.js 18+
- pnpm
- AI provider credentials
## Clone and Build
Use the source-build workflow if you want to run Shannon from a local clone, modify the open-source CLI, or keep the worker image built locally.
```bash
# 1. Clone Shannon.
git clone https://github.com/KeygraphHQ/shannon.git
cd shannon
# 2. Configure credentials.
cp .env.example .env
# 3. Install dependencies and build.
pnpm install
pnpm build
# 4. Run a pentest.
./shannon start -u https://your-app.com -r /path/to/your-repo
```
At minimum, your `.env` file should include one supported AI provider credential, such as:
```bash
ANTHROPIC_API_KEY=your-api-key
```
Environment variables can also be exported directly:
```bash
export ANTHROPIC_API_KEY="your-api-key"
```
## Prepare Your Repository
Shannon can scan any repository on your machine. Pass an absolute or relative path with `-r`.
```bash
npx @keygraph/shannon start -u https://example.com -r /path/to/repo
./shannon start -u https://example.com -r ./relative/path
```
The target repository is mounted read-only inside the worker container.
## Common Commands
Monitor progress:
```bash
npx @keygraph/shannon logs [<workspace>] # defaults to the single running scan, else the most recent
npx @keygraph/shannon status [<workspace>] # same default target; add --json for a machine-readable snapshot
npx @keygraph/shannon scans
npx @keygraph/shannon version
```
With no workspace, `logs` and `status` follow the single running scan; when several are running, name one.
Source-build equivalents:
```bash
./shannon logs [<workspace>] # the combined live log (unchanged default)
./shannon logs [<workspace>] --agent <name> # tail one agent's own log
./shannon logs [<workspace>] --list-agents # list the agents with their own log
./shannon status [<workspace>]
./shannon scans
./shannon version
```
Every scan writes one combined `.shannon/workflow.log` and a per-agent projection of it under
`.shannon/agents/`: one file per pipeline agent (`recon.log`, `xss-vuln.log`, …) and one per Capella
stage (`agentic-sast-research.log`, …). Delegated subagents fold into their parent's file, and a
Capella stage's concurrent sessions share its file with an inline session label. The combined log
stays canonical; the per-agent files are best-effort projections.
Open the Temporal Web UI for detailed monitoring:
```bash
open http://localhost:8233
```
Stop Shannon:
```bash
npx @keygraph/shannon stop [<workspace>] # stop one scan (defaults to the single running scan; confirms first; add --yes/-y to skip)
npx @keygraph/shannon stop --all # stop all scans (Temporal stays up)
npx @keygraph/shannon reset # stop everything and wipe all Temporal data (type 'confirm' to proceed; cannot be skipped)
```
Source-build equivalents:
```bash
./shannon stop [<workspace>] # stop one scan (defaults to the single running scan; confirms first; add --yes/-y to skip)
./shannon stop --all # stop all scans (Temporal stays up)
./shannon reset # stop everything and wipe all Temporal data (type 'confirm' to proceed; cannot be skipped)
```
Usage examples:
```bash
# Basic pentest.
npx @keygraph/shannon start -u https://example.com -r /path/to/repo
# With a configuration file.
npx @keygraph/shannon start -u https://example.com -r /path/to/repo -c /path/to/my-config.yaml
# Custom output directory.
npx @keygraph/shannon start -u https://example.com -r /path/to/repo -o ./my-reports
# Named workspace.
npx @keygraph/shannon start -u https://example.com -r /path/to/repo -w q1-audit
# Stream the log until the scan finishes, then exit on its outcome (useful in CI).
npx @keygraph/shannon start -u https://example.com -r /path/to/repo --follow
# List running and completed scans.
npx @keygraph/shannon scans
```
Source-build examples:
```bash
./shannon start -u https://example.com -r /path/to/repo
./shannon start -u https://example.com -r /path/to/repo -c /path/to/my-config.yaml
./shannon start -u https://example.com -r /path/to/repo -o ./my-reports
./shannon start -u https://example.com -r /path/to/repo -w q1-audit
./shannon start -u https://example.com -r /path/to/repo --follow
./shannon scans
# Rebuild the worker image.
./shannon build --no-cache
```
## Output and Results
Results are saved to the workspaces directory:
- `./workspaces/` in source-build mode
- `~/.shannon/workspaces/` in `npx` mode
Use `-o <path>` to copy deliverables to a custom output directory after a run completes.
Output structure — the run directory's top level holds the final report, in PDF and Markdown; everything else is nested under a hidden `.shannon/` directory:
```text
workspaces/{hostname}_{sessionId}/
|-- Security-Assessment-Report.pdf # the final report (PDF)
|-- Security-Assessment-Report.md # the final report (Markdown)
`-- .shannon/ # internals
|-- deliverables/ # report source, per-phase analysis, queues
|-- agents/ # per-agent log projections, one file per agent/Capella stage
|-- prompts/ # rendered prompts
|-- scratchpad/ # screenshots, scripts
|-- session.json # resume state
`-- workflow.log
```
